Balance of Nature as Ecological Imaginary (AFS presentation)

Tarangire National Park, Tanzania. Courtesty of Zenith 4237, Wikimedia Commons.

 

 On Saturday, November 4, our DERT (Diverse Environmental Research Team) group led a forum at the American Folklore Society annual conference on the subject of Ecological Imaginaries. My brief presentation was on the idea of the balance of nature as a Euro-American ecological imaginary. Here's what I said:

      I want to speak about one of Euro-America’s enduring myths, the ecological imaginary that is called the balance of nature. By myth here I don’t mean something supernatural. I mean a metanarrative that imbues history with teleology; that is, nature exhibits aesthetic and ethical purpose. Nature is said to be balanced in the sense that just as water seeks its own level, nature possesses a kind of economy. In other words, left pretty much to its own devices, nature finds an equilibrium about which it can sustain itself indefinitely. In scientific terms, balanced natural ecosystems are self-regulating, like a pendulum, or like a thermostat moving the temperature about a set point. A corollary is the diversity-stability hypothesis: that ecosystem stability increases with biodiversity.

     Of course, you’ve heard of the virtues of balance in daily life. We’re told to eat a balanced diet. If you’ve streamed television lately you’ve surely seen ads for the dietary supplement called balance of nature, with one pill containing vegetables and the other fruits in powdered form. Talk about ultra-processed foods! and yet they’re advertised as healthful. And surely you know the folkloric expression “don’t keep all your eggs in one basket.” This actually is a proverbial expression of the diversity-stability hypothesis.

     Well, the balance of nature is an old idea that one can find from ancient and medieval European history through the Enlightenment and Modernity. About “the economy of nature” the great naturalist Linnaeus wrote that “Providence not only aimed at sustaining, but also keeping a just proportion amongst all the species.” Darwin’s evolutionary natural selection is but a secular expression of natural balance. In the 20th century, the idea of the ecosystem, with its food chain and food web, its producers, consumers, and decomposers, became the model for ecological study, taken as instances of natural balance. Balance of nature among organisms, populations, communities and ecosystems organized the major ecology textbooks throughout most of the last century.

     Ecology also provided scientific support for the efforts of conservationists and environmentalists in the last century. Some ecological scientists, such as Rachel Carson and Eugene Odom, also became environmentalists and helped bring about the EPA and its public policies that are intended to protect endangered species (including ourselves) from pathogenic industrial civilization and restore ecological balance.

     Probably the most far-reaching contemporary example of natural balance is Gaia. Gaia, as you know, is the name for the hypothesis that the Earth itself is alive—that is, that the Earth considered as a whole, all the plants and animals and geological formations and its atmosphere, is naturally self-regulating and seeks a sustainable equilibrium. In other words, Gaia represents balance of nature and diversity-stability writ large. Gaia theory has been endorsed by environmentalists of all stripes, from practical problem-solvers to so-called deep ecologists.

     There is, however, a problem with balance of nature in the 21st century. Not only do the vast majority of ecological scientists not accept Gaia, balance of nature has been discarded by ecological science. As early as 1973 ecologist Robert May demonstrated that the more diverse was an ecosystem, the more fragile it was. It now seems as if stability does not depend on biodiversity. Other ecologists observed environmental complexity that could only be explained by chaos theory, leading to the current ecosystem paradigm, which indicates that when confronted with significant disturbances, complex ecosystems disintegrate. Today's ecological scientists portray the state of nature not in terms of economy and balance but by its opposite: instability, flux, and complexity (chaos), whether humankind’s hand is present or absent.

     Nevertheless, the myth of a balanced nature persists among environmentalists and in the public mind. It even affects public policy. I don’t have time to get into details here, but consider whether, if and when carbon neutrality or net zero emissions is actually achieved, the Earth’s climate will swing back into its previous, desirable balance point, or remain in its then-current regime and continue to wreak havoc.

     Summing up, then: balance of nature is a powerful ecological imaginary. Balance of nature is also a national myth, the kind of myth that folklorists such as Alan Dundes wrote about in Work Hard and You Shall Be Rewarded (the Horatio Alger myth) or Dick Dorson wrote about, such as the frontier myth, when his topic was folklore in America versus American folklore. The expressive culture of balance of nature offers a fertile field for folkloric exploration, whether the subject is dietary supplements or climate change. Many of us are going to end with a question for everyone in the room. Mine is this: how does balance of nature figure in your ecological imaginary, and how does it figure in the ecological imaginaries of the people who are your field partners?

Ecological Imaginaries 1

The Land of Cockaigne, painting by Pieter Bruegel the elder, 1567

     Our Diverse Environmentalist Research Team faculty seminar will be discussing aspects of the topic “ecological imaginaries” starting in November. Each of us is to prepare some thoughts on this concept which has many possibilities. Here are four that occur to me immediately. There are some others I want to investigate, but this will be a start.

    1. Pastoral as ecological imaginary. This is the Arcadian tradition, in which humans live in harmony with and in nature. Literally of course it evokes shepherds and their flocks in the countryside, but symbolically pastoral does a great deal of work in the Romantic traditions of literature and philosophy, whether in German naturphilosophie or the poetry of Wordsworth and Coleridge’s Lyrical Ballads. Thoreau’s Walden is usually regarded as pastoral, and the ecocritic Leo Marx worked American pastoral into an explanation of American intellectual history and its ambivalence toward industrialism. This Romantic ambivalence is also responsible, of course, for the concept of “folk,” das volk, as an uneasiness with modernism—not just industrialism, but also economic rationality ("economic man") and reductionist Western science.
    2. Related to pastoral and a projection of “folk” is the ecological imaginary of the “Land of Cockaigne,” a medieval alternative universe of pleasure and plenty, a utopian paradise of license. The 13th century French poem portrayed a land where people did not have to work, goods were freely available, game gave itself up to hunters, fish leapt out of the water and into the cooking kettle, and people never aged or died. There are some parallels with visions of the Christian heaven here. A 20th-century song, “The Big Rock Candy Mountain,” expresses the ecological imaginary of Cockaigne as a hobo’s paradise where hens lay soft-boiled eggs, trees leaf out in cigarettes, and lakewater is whiskey. That song was composed by “Haywire Mac” Harry McClintock around the turn of the 20th century and first recorded by him in 1928. Since that recording it has become widely sung and known in variant forms, even appearing in a 2005 Burger King commercial.
    3. A third ecological imaginary is the idea of untrammeled wilderness, wild nature untouched by human intervention. The Romans had a word for this, res nullius, which they distinguished from res commones (commons, things that by their nature could not be owned, such as the air mantle and the oceans), res publicae (public things, owned by the state, such as roads and bridges), and res privatae (private things). Res nullius (no one's things) was a kind of terra incognita; it was conceived of as that part of the world that had not (yet) been “captured” by human beings. Wild nature is not peaceful nor is it pastoral; as Colonial Governor William Bradford wrote in 1640 of Massachussetts when the first European settlers came, that the land was filled with “wild beasts and wild men.” But this is of course a frontier imaginary; the “wild men” had been transforming the land for millennia by hunting, farming, fishing, burning to clear the land, and so on. Thoreau thought he had experienced “untrammeled nature” when, as he relates in The Maine Woods, he became frightened while descending Maine’s Mt. Katahdin and was surrounded by the rocky landscape that looked to him untouched by humans—it might as well have been the far side of the moon as far as he was concerned.
    4. A fourth ecological imaginary, related to the first two, is the notion of a self-regulating or balanced nature, or the ecosystems of the world as organic wholes, most recently expressed on a planetary scale by Lovelock and Margulis’ concept of Gaia. Although the idea of a balance of nature can be found in Greek thought, Gilbert White’s The History of Selborne, and of course in the Romantic philosophical and literary traditions, as well as pastoral, it has also captivated a number of ecological scientists and is usually expressed in concepts such as “climax” or “equilibrium.” Related to holism and organicism, it is not currently in fashion, but for much of the last century it vied with its opposite, the idea that the normal state of nature was not equilibrium but rather disturbance, flux and change until in the century’s last few decades it was largely abandoned. But this is not to say that balances do not exist in nature; they do: but the idea that nature overall and absent the hand of human intervention (itself as much a fantasy as Hobbes’ idea of a “state of nature”) tends toward balance is not widely believed by ecological scientists today.

Resilience

    When I was in Portland, Oregon last February at the round table with various musicians, musicologists, acoustic planners and city arts managers I was struck by something one of them, Tim DuRoche, said when he introduced the term “resiliency” and suggested it might be a better way of thinking than “sustainability.” Tim spoke about resiliency in ecological terms, saying that while sustainability implied preservation, he wanted to manage the arts for growth and change. He spoke about improvisation in music (he is a jazz musician as well as an arts administrator) as adaptation, with resiliency a key component. I embraced that idea, commenting that “resiliency” is a term that has emerged in contemporary ecological thought, to describe management strategies for complex systems where mathematical modeling and predictability is difficult if not impossible. I added, though, that in ecological thinking today, sustainability is allied more with adaptation and resiliency than with preservation.

    Resiliency planning is a strategy for protection against unpredictable disturbances in (and to) nature and against the law of unintended consequences. It arose from a critique of the ecosystem paradigm, a way of thinking about natural worlds that stood at the center of ecological thought from 1935 when Arthur Tansley coined the term "ecosystem" until about 1970 when the critique gained traction. In my 2009 essay “Music and Sustainability: An Ecological Approach” I had noted the part of this critique that is directed at equilibrium theory in ecosystems, but I maintained that four principles from conservation biology/ecology, the principles of limits to growth, diversity, interconnectedness, and stewardship, should guide cultural policy planning for music cultures. After all, conservation biology/ecology developed beginning in the 1970s, just as the critique was making its force felt. What I had not done was explore the extent to which that critique affects those principles, nor why that critique made me think of a kind of sustainability that tilts away from preservation of cultural heritage and towards adaptation and change, the same conception that Tim DuRoche alluded to when he spoke about resiliency. And since that conversation with Tim and the others in Oregon it nagged at me that I had not done so, and that perhaps I had not yet gotten it quite right, either. I resolved to take up this line of research again this summer after the teaching semester was over. As I did so, a number of questions resurfaced, ones that I want to explore further in blog entries during the next several months.

    First, the critique. Two of the linchpins of twentieth-century ecological theory were challenged beginning in the 1970s and are largely discredited by ecologists today. One is the idea, associated with Frederick Clements in the first decades of the 20th century, that forests and other natural units, when left alone as “wild nature,” pass through successive stages toward a diverse, stable, mature, and final or “climax” stage. The second is the idea, implied by Clements’s notion of succession and climax, and associated with the influential mid-twentieth century work of ecological scientists Howard and Eugene Odum, that mature ecosystems are those in which organisms, populations, and communities exist in a dynamic equilibrium characterized by energy flows and cycles (modeled mathematically) governing birth, growth, decay, and regeneration. These two ideas not only constituted the scientific discipline of ecology but also guided conservation efforts and environmental management in the last half of the twentieth century, and provided scientific grounding for what those who write for the general public sometimes term “nature’s way” or, more often, “the balance of (wild) nature.” But today's ecological scientists no longer believe in climax theory, nor in ecosystems whose normal state is dynamic equilibrium, nor in a balance of nature.

   I make a distinction between ecological science and environmentalism. The latter is an outgrowth of the conservation movement, and it involves many stakeholders besides ecological scientists: naturalists, conservationists, eco-tourists, policy makers, organic farmers, ecocritics, landowners, and those within the extractive industries such as mining, forestry, and agriculture that wish to use and renew natural resources, not use them up. Indeed, ecological scientists are not necessarily part of the environmental movement and many have strong reservations about it. Conservation biology is a branch of ecology that is very much a part of the environmental movement, but most ecological scientists are not conservation biologists. Most lay environmentalists today still believe that nature “naturally” moves towards balance; but ecologists no longer share that belief, while their research also questions the basis for correspondence between diversity and stability in ecosystems. Indeed, the ecosystem concept itself, which once ruled ecology, is no longer at the center of the discipline. How did this happen, why did it happen, and what does it mean, for ecology, environmentalism, and sustainability? Where do conservation biologists stand on the matter? Where has ecological science moved in response to this critique, what is the center of the discipline today, and what are the implications of this change for musical and cultural sustainability? Have the four sustainability principles from conservation biology/ecology been undermined or strengthened by this paradigm shift, and how might they be modified to suit the brave new ecological world?

Systems and sustainability at the EPA

The federal Environmental Protection Agency “is undertaking what some call a ‘seismic shift in the way it works: making ‘sustainability’ its central goal,” said Bruce Gellerman on this morning’s public radio broadcast of Living on Earth. Jeff Young interviewed the new head of the EPA, Paul Anastas, who explained that instead of targeting for specific interventions, he “wants his scientists to think more broadly about systems and sustainability.” Anastas explained using climate change as an example: “Climate is inextricably linked to energy, energy inextricably linked to water, water to agriculture, agriculture to health, and we could go on and on. If we start saying that the entirety of our approach to sustainability is simply to reduce our carbon footprint or to look at any one aspect, then we will not be getting the power and potential of the synergies of looking from a systems approach.”

Anastas’ adoption of the systems approach indeed represents that shift from conservation thinking, in which particular problems such as endangered species are addressed by specific interventions, to ecological thinking, in which the principle of interconnectedness guides policy makers to look at the consequences of specific interventions in the context of the interdependence of the whole system or ecosystem. This is precisely the shift in thinking that I have been proposing for cultural interventions, based on the principle of interconnectedness, one of the four principles I’ve been speaking and writing about. I explain it most thoroughly in my essay, "Music and Sustainability: An Ecological Viewpoint," in The World of Music, Vol. 51, No. 1 (2009), pp. 119-138.

 This kind of thinking underlies my proposals to feed the cultural soil, so to speak, rather than the particular arts or genres; in other words, to concentrate efforts in musical and cultural sustainability on improving the conditions that give a life to traditional music and expressive culture, rather than simply targeting endangered musical cultures for support, as UNESCO (the major institution involved in cultural sustainability throughout the world) has been doing in its efforts to safeguard intangible cultural heritage. I would hope that the same kind of shift in strategy that the new EPA head is espousing would translate to the institutions that are making cultural policy—not only UNESCO, but national agencies as well, such as arts councils, museums, historical societies, and traffickers in cultural and musical heritage.

But I’d add a word of caution. This kind of holistic thinking, which Anastas is adopting at the EPA, envisions a paradigmatic environmental system, one that claims that large ecosystems move through a succession of stages towards a balanced state in dynamic equilibrium. The climax forest concept is the usual example. But some contemporary ecologists have discarded this model of a balance of Nature in favor of one based in evolutionary biology, with blind chance and mutation as the driving factors over the (very) long term. This newer paradigm challenges Nature's economy (a concept that, incidentally, Darwin himself believed) and posits disturbance and disequilibrium as the new normal. Climate change on Earth, as it has occurred over hundreds of millions of years, is taken as the usual example. Because my thinking here is informed by ecology, it would be irresponsible not to consider this newer paradigm—welcomed in some quarters, damned in others—and its consequences, for music, cultural policy, and sustainability. I intend to do so in a number of future posts, particularly as I examine the role of music and sound in evolution. Evolution, as I wrote here many months ago, was once a forbidden topic among ethnomusicologists, but climate change effects ideas as well as temperature.

A visit to Portland, Oregon

    I'm just back from an exciting trip to Portland, Oregon, one of the most environmentally conscious areas of the U.S. Professor Darrell Grant, of the music department at Portland State University, invited me to speak on how music might take a seat at the table where sustainability was under discussion. He'd told me that sustainability was an important topic of conversation in his city, and that much good work was being done; but people were puzzled about how music fit into the civic dialogue. Darrell Grant is an active member of the university and the Portland community, a graduate of the Eastman School of Music, a highly regarded teacher and jazz pianist, and a citizen concerned with the health of the music community and the Portland soundscape. Last fall, out of the blue, he invited me to kick off a series of lectures on music and sustainability sponsored by the music department as part of the university's sustainability initiative. He'd run into this blog, read it, and hoped I'd be willing to share some of my thoughts with the Portland community.

    In addition to the lecture, Darrell arranged a 90-minute morning round table to which he'd invited not only members of the music department and the university at large who were interested in the topic, professors from sociology and English, for example, but also several people involved with the city's soundscape, including urban planners, acoustic ecologists, arts administrators, architects, and the president of the local musicians' union, all for a dialogue around music's place in the city's ongoing efforts at sustainability.

    On Friday morning while eating breakfast I read the city paper, The Oregonian, and found an entire section devoted to "How We Live: Sustainability." The lead article was on Oregon State University's new green energy center; other articles discussed an exhibit of Whale Island petroglyphs from the Wampanum tribe, a documentary film entitled The Economics of Happiness, sponsored by Portland's Center for Earth Leadership, a public symposium on policy planning for the Williamette River watershed, a tree plantation repair work project, meant to improve stream health and restore wildlife habitat, and seeking volunteers; a film about the vanishing bees; and more. Writer Carrie Sturrock's column, "PDX Green" (PDX is the abbreviation for Portland), quoted Dick Roy, of the Center for Earth Leadership: "If everyone became a naturalist and understood the geology of the region and the history of the region and had a commitment to place, then the place we are isn't just a commodity. Then you have a foundation of people living in place who accept deep responsibility for it." Sturrock concluded that "Consequently, it becomes more easy and natural to support local businesses and farmers rooted in place." I felt grateful to be in such an environmentally-conscious place as Portland, with like-minded people.


    The music department representatives spoke about the mission statement they'd drafted concerning music and sustainability, in the process discovering many different interests and voices. I likened this, and the additional voices at the table, to the acoustic ecology of the tropical rain forest, where the voices of birds, reptiles, insects (yes, they make sounds by rubbing parts of their bodies together), and other animals all can be heard, not in a cacophony but each species with their particular acoustic niche, and where they can communicate with one another. A sociology professor picked up on this idea, saying that in her work she's very much concerned with the role of music in the health and solidarity of human communities.

    One of the Portland city community members spoke about music's quality of resilience, both in preference to the term sustainability, and as a supplement to it. He was speaking about the resilience of musical cultures and musicians as well, and instanced resilience as a quality that enabled music to survive in the face of change. This stimulated me to suggest to the group that resilience was one of the more important ecological concepts. A few of the people at the round table were aware that in the last  forty years or so the idea that ecosystems tend toward a state of dynamic equilibrium, exemplified in the climax forest, has been severely challenged by an opposite hypothesis, namely that disturbance rather than equilibrium is the natural tendency, that the ecosystem is no system at all, and that entropy and the Second Law of Thermodynamics characterize the natural world. Against this movement toward disorder, randomness, and chaos, however, I said that the natural world does exhibit resilience; and certainly the resilience of musical cultures is analogous.

    After everyone had a chance to speak and introduce themselves and their concerns, I noted that their concerns fell broadly into two topics: (1) the sustainability of music into the future, and (2) the role of music in the sustainability of life on planet Earth. These concerns, I said, lead us to formulate cultural policy in regard to music. Sustainability is a new word, but cultural policy has been concerned with the sustainability of music for a very long time. For example, music education has been going on for centuries; its goal is the sustainability of music and musical cultures. Beginning in the nineteenth century, efforts were under way to preserve musical artifacts in museums; before that, in private collections. Conservation was another form of cultural policy, ancient in regard to patronage, such as music supported by courts and governments throughout the world; but in the last part of the 20th century, cultural policy involving conservation began to target endangered musics for support, just as conservation efforts in the natural world were targeting endangered species.

    After critiquing targeted interventions, I pointed out that in the last decade or two, cultural policy has moved from conservation efforts in support of music to a view of music as an arm of economic policy, and I mentioned the ways in which cultural policymakers were bringing music and the arts into what was being termed the creative economy, as a spur to technological innovation and economic growth. It was interesting to see some resistance at the round table to the creative economy argument, as if there were something crass about it. Instead, as one of the community members put it, cultural policy should view music as an important component of happiness and well-being. I told them that music, art, gift, commodity, and the creative economy is an area I will be exploring in invited lectures later this winter and spring.

    Toward the end of the long and productive discussion, the talk turned toward the influence of the Internet on the future of music. Professional musicians, indeed the profession of music itself, was going to have to change, said the president of the musicians' union. How would it be possible for professional composers and musicians to continue earning a living, if society was moving away from the idea that musical product and performance is intellectual property that should be protected by copyright? Some felt that it would be difficult for older musicians to adapt, and that the future would see more musicians making less money. Some of the younger people at the table pointed out that while the Internet was moving toward free delivery of recordings, the circulation possibilities for music and access for musicians were increasing enormously, to the point that more musicians would be making more money in the future, not from music available on the Internet, but from concerts and recordings sold at concerts (which were not available on the Internet). Afterward many of the participants mentioned that they had been reading this blog with pleasure and were glad to meet the author; some had been reading it for more than a year or two.

    Friday evening’s lecture concentrated on the implications of the Four Principles from conservation biology (diversity, interdependence, limits to growth, and stewardship) for cultural policy regarding music. I spoke about these, thinking that in such an ecologically-conscious community, this aspect of the topic would be of more interest than others. I spoke about stewardship and partnership, had them sing an Old Regular Baptist lined hymn with me, and then talked at length about how the Old Regular Baptists had been able to conserve and revitalize their 425-year-old singing tradition.

    I was going to conclude by talking about the Lilley Cornett Woods, the only old-growth forest left in eastern Kentucky, but I ran out of time. The Lilley Cornett Woods is located in the same southeastern part of the state as the Old Regular Baptists. In fact, the hymn we listened to, and then sang, was one that I recorded in a church not more than a few miles away from the Lilley Cornett Woods. So I will leave for another time the story of Lilley Cornett and the 500 acres of original growth forest he bought after World War I on his miner’s wages, and preserved because he wouldn’t sell out to the timber cutters and the coal companies. Nor would the Old Regular Baptists sell out to the musical reformers, whether the purveyors of music literacy, shaped notes and gospel music in the 19th century, or the dominance of gospel music (what some of them call "radio songs") in the 20th. It’s not a coincidence that the Old Regular Baptists and the Lilley Cornett Woods inhabit the same geographical and cultural space.
